Dark Secrets of Childhood: Media Power, Child Abuse and Public Scandals
Powell, Fred (Department of Applied Social Studies, National University of Ireland, Cork)
This ground-breaking book explores the relationship between the media, child abuse and shifting adult–child power relations which, in Western countries, has spawned an ever-expanding range of laws, policies and procedures introduced to address the ‘explosion’ of interest in the issue of child abuse.
